在网络通信领域,碰撞检测与避免是确保数据传输效率和准确性的关键技术之一。IPW(Inter-Packet Wavelength)碰撞仿真作为一种有效的网络性能分析工具,对于优化网络协议和提升网络质量具有重要意义。本文将揭秘如何轻松掌握IPW碰撞仿真技巧,帮助你解决网络连接难题。
理解IPW碰撞与仿真
1. 什么是IPW碰撞?
IPW碰撞指的是在同一传输媒介上,两个或多个数据包同时发送导致的数据冲突。这种情况在无线网络、光纤通信等领域尤为常见。当发生碰撞时,数据包需要重新发送,这不仅降低了网络传输效率,还可能引发更多的碰撞,形成恶性循环。
2. 什么是IPW碰撞仿真?
IPW碰撞仿真是一种通过模拟网络环境,预测和评估不同网络协议或配置对碰撞发生概率的影响的技术。通过仿真,可以分析不同参数设置下的网络性能,为网络优化提供理论依据。
掌握IPW碰撞仿真技巧
1. 熟悉网络协议与原理
要想掌握IPW碰撞仿真,首先需要对网络协议及其原理有深入了解。熟悉TCP/IP、以太网等基础协议的工作原理,有助于你理解碰撞产生的原因,并设计有效的仿真场景。
2. 选择合适的仿真工具
目前市面上有多种IPW碰撞仿真工具,如NS-2、NS-3等。选择一个功能强大、易于操作的仿真工具是成功进行仿真的关键。以下是一些选择工具时可以考虑的因素:
- 功能全面:选择支持多种网络协议、仿真场景和参数配置的工具。
- 易于操作:图形化界面、清晰的文档和教程能帮助你更快上手。
- 性能优异:强大的仿真能力能够模拟复杂网络环境,提高仿真准确性。
3. 设计合理的仿真实验
在设计仿真实验时,应考虑以下因素:
- 仿真场景:根据实际需求,设计合适的网络拓扑结构、节点配置和传输参数。
- 仿真参数:设定碰撞窗口、发送间隔、数据包大小等关键参数。
- 数据收集与分析:在仿真过程中收集碰撞次数、传输效率等数据,并对结果进行分析。
4. 分析仿真结果
通过对仿真结果的分析,可以了解不同参数设置对碰撞概率和传输效率的影响。以下是一些常用的分析方法:
- 统计分析:对碰撞次数、传输时间等数据进行统计分析,评估网络性能。
- 可视化分析:将仿真结果以图表形式展示,直观地展示网络性能的变化。
- 对比分析:对比不同仿真场景或参数设置下的网络性能,寻找最佳配置。
解决网络连接难题
通过掌握IPW碰撞仿真技巧,可以有效地解决网络连接难题。以下是一些实际应用案例:
- 优化网络拓扑:通过仿真分析,可以找到最佳的节点部署和连接方式,提高网络传输效率。
- 改进协议设计:根据仿真结果,可以对现有网络协议进行优化,降低碰撞概率。
- 预测网络性能:通过仿真,可以预测未来网络性能,为网络扩容和升级提供依据。
总结
掌握IPW碰撞仿真技巧对于解决网络连接难题具有重要意义。通过熟悉网络协议、选择合适的仿真工具、设计合理的仿真实验和深入分析仿真结果,可以有效地提升网络性能,为网络通信提供有力保障。
